Taiwanese Popcorn Tofu has a special place in my heart, reminding me of bustling night markets and vibrant street food. I still remember the first time I tasted this incredible snack; the aroma of five-spice and basil was intoxicating, and the crispy exterior gave way to a tender, flavorful interior. It was love at first bite! This Crispy Taiwanese Tofu recipe captures that authentic street food magic, allowing you to recreate the experience right in your own kitchen. You’ll be amazed at how simple it is to make delicious and easy plant-based Taiwanese popcorn chicken. Let’s get cooking!
Why You’ll Love This Taiwanese Popcorn Tofu
I promise, once you try this recipe, it will become a new favorite in your household. Here’s why I adore making this flavorful snack:
- It’s incredibly delicious, offering a perfect balance of savory spices and a satisfying crunch.
- The prep time is minimal, making it an ideal option for a quick weeknight appetizer or snack.
- It’s a healthier alternative to many fried snacks, especially when you consider it’s a Taiwanese Popcorn Tofu dish made with plant-based ingredients.
- Making your own Vegan Taiwanese Popcorn Chicken at home is surprisingly budget-friendly compared to takeout.
- This recipe is a fantastic way to introduce more plant-based meals to your family, even picky eaters love these crispy bites.
- You get all the flavor and texture of traditional popcorn chicken, but in a delicious and guilt-free Vegan Taiwanese Popcorn Chicken form.
- It’s versatile; you can easily adjust the spice level to suit everyone’s preferences.
- The aroma alone will fill your kitchen with the enticing scents of authentic Taiwanese street food.
Ingredients for Taiwanese Popcorn Tofu
To create this amazing Taiwanese fried tofu recipe, you’ll need just a few key ingredients. I’ve found that using high-quality components makes all the difference in achieving that authentic flavor and perfect texture. Here’s a breakdown of what you’ll need for your homemade Taiwanese Popcorn Tofu:
- 1 block Extra Firm Tofu – I always recommend freezing and then thawing it. This creates a spongier texture that soaks up the marinade beautifully.
- 2 tablespoons Light Soy Sauce – This adds a foundational savory depth. For those avoiding gluten, tamari works perfectly as a substitute.
- 1 tablespoon Shaoxing Wine – This is my secret for that classic Taiwanese flavor, but if you prefer non-alcoholic, rice vinegar is a good alternative.
- 1 teaspoon Five Spice Powder – Essential for the aromatic profile of Taiwanese Popcorn Tofu. Garam masala can offer a similar warmth if needed.
- 1/2 teaspoon White Pepper – A must-have for that characteristic subtle kick. Black pepper can be used if white pepper isn’t available.
- 2 tablespoons Corn Starch – Used in the marinade to help tenderize the tofu and create a slight coating for the tapioca starch to adhere to.
- 1 cup Tapioca Starch – This is critical for achieving that signature crispy exterior. Arrowroot starch is a decent stand-in if you can’t find tapioca.
- 1 cup Thai Basil Leaves – Fresh basil fried alongside the tofu adds an incredible aroma and flavor. Regular basil can be used if Thai basil is hard to find.
- to taste Seasoning (Five Spice, White Pepper, Salt, Paprika) – This final sprinkle elevates the taste, making your Taiwanese Popcorn Tofu truly irresistible.
How to Make Taiwanese Popcorn Tofu
Making this incredible Taiwanese Popcorn Tofu is simpler than you might think, and the results are truly rewarding. I love how the process transforms humble tofu into a crispy, flavorful snack that rivals any street food. Follow these steps carefully to achieve the perfect texture and taste that makes this dish so popular.
- Step 1: First, prepare your tofu. In a mixing bowl, combine your light soy sauce, Shaoxing wine, five spice powder, white pepper, salt, and corn starch. Whisk these ingredients together until you have a smooth marinade. Add your cubed extra firm tofu, making sure each piece is thoroughly coated. Cover the bowl and refrigerate for at least 20 minutes, or up to 4 hours, to allow the tofu to really soak up all those wonderful flavors. This marinating step is key to delicious Taiwanese Popcorn Tofu.
- Step 2: While your tofu is marinating, prepare your frying station. Pour the tapioca starch into a shallow dish – this will be your coating. Next, heat enough oil in a deep frying pan or pot over medium-high heat. You’re looking for the oil to be hot enough to sizzle immediately when a small piece of tofu is dropped in, usually around 350-375°F (175-190°C). Getting the oil temperature right is crucial for crispy results.
- Step 3: Retrieve your marinated tofu. Carefully dredge each piece in the tapioca starch, ensuring it’s completely and evenly coated. Don’t press too hard; a light, even coating is what you want. This coating is what will give your Taiwanese Popcorn Tofu its signature crunch.
- Step 4: Gently lower the coated tofu pieces into the hot oil. Work in batches to avoid overcrowding the pan, which can lower the oil temperature and lead to soggy tofu. Fry for 5-6 minutes, or until the pieces are beautifully golden brown and crispy, stirring occasionally to ensure even cooking.
- Step 5: During the last minute of frying, add the fresh Thai basil leaves to the hot oil. They will crisp up quickly, adding an incredible aromatic element to your dish. This is an authentic touch that elevates the flavor profile.
- Step 6: Once cooked, immediately transfer the crispy tofu and fried basil onto a paper towel-lined plate to drain any excess oil. This step helps keep your Taiwanese Popcorn Tofu perfectly crisp. In a small bowl, mix your ground seasoning (five-spice, white pepper, salt, and paprika). Generously sprinkle this mixture over the hot tofu and basil. Serve immediately and enjoy your homemade crispy snack! This is truly how to make Taiwanese Popcorn Tofu that’s unforgettable.

Pro Tips for the Best Taiwanese Popcorn Tofu
Over the years, I’ve learned a few tricks that consistently elevate my Taiwanese Popcorn Tofu from good to absolutely amazing. These simple tips will help you achieve that perfect texture and flavor every single time, making your homemade version truly stand out. Trust me, these small details make a big difference in the final outcome of your crispy tofu.
- Always use extra-firm tofu and freeze it first. This creates those desirable pockets for marinade absorption and a chewier texture.
- Don’t skimp on the marinating time; the longer the tofu soaks, the deeper the flavor will be throughout each piece.
- Ensure your oil is at the correct temperature before frying. Too cool, and your tofu will be greasy; too hot, and it will burn before cooking through.
- Fry in small batches to maintain oil temperature and prevent the tofu from sticking together, which is crucial for even crispiness.
- Sprinkle the seasoning generously over the tofu immediately after frying when it’s still hot, so the spices adhere better.
What’s the secret to perfect Authentic Taiwanese popcorn tofu?
The real secret lies in the double starch coating and high-temperature frying. Using corn starch in the marinade and tapioca starch for the final dredge creates an incredibly crisp exterior that locks in moisture. This method is key for any Best Taiwanese popcorn tofu recipe, ensuring that satisfying crunch.
Can I make Taiwanese Popcorn Tofu ahead of time?
You can certainly prep some components in advance! Marinate the tofu up to 24 hours ahead and store it in the refrigerator. However, for the crispiest results, I always recommend frying the Taiwanese Popcorn Tofu just before serving. This ensures maximum freshness and crunch.
How do I avoid common mistakes with Easy Taiwanese popcorn tofu recipe?
The most common pitfalls are overcrowding the pan and not having hot enough oil. Fry in small batches to keep the oil temperature consistent. Also, make sure each piece of tofu is fully coated in tapioca starch; this prevents sticking and guarantees that signature crispiness for your Easy Taiwanese popcorn tofu recipe.
Best Ways to Serve Taiwanese Popcorn Tofu
Once you’ve mastered making this delicious Taiwanese Popcorn Tofu, you’ll want to know the best ways to enjoy it! I find that its versatility makes it perfect for various occasions. Here are my favorite serving suggestions to truly elevate your crispy tofu experience.
For a classic street food vibe, serve your Taiwanese Popcorn Tofu piping hot in a paper cone with a side of sweet chili sauce or a garlicky soy dipping sauce. The combination of savory, spicy, and sweet is absolutely irresistible. It’s truly the best way to enjoy this Taiwanese deep-fried tofu as a snack.

You can also turn it into a satisfying meal by serving it alongside a fresh, crisp salad with a light vinaigrette, or with a bowl of steamed jasmine rice. The slight acidity from the salad dressing or the plain rice perfectly balances the rich, aromatic flavors of the tofu. Sometimes, I even add a sprinkle of toasted sesame seeds for an extra layer of texture and nutty flavor to my homemade Taiwanese Popcorn Tofu. It’s a fantastic plant-based dinner option.
Nutrition Facts for Taiwanese Popcorn Tofu
I know many of you are curious about the nutritional breakdown of this delicious snack. Here’s an estimated look at the nutrition per serving for your homemade Taiwanese Popcorn Tofu, based on the ingredients and preparation method. This information helps you enjoy your crispy treat mindfully.
- Serving Size: 1 serving
- Calories: 250 kcal
- Fat: 15 g
- Saturated Fat: 1 g
- Unsaturated Fat: 9 g
- Trans Fat: 0 g
- Carbohydrates: 20 g
- Fiber: 2 g
- Sugar: 1 g
- Protein: 12 g
- Sodium: 600 mg
- Cholesterol: 0 mg
Please remember that these nutritional values are estimates and may vary based on specific brands, ingredient substitutions, and exact portion sizes of your Taiwanese Popcorn Tofu.
How to Store and Reheat Taiwanese Popcorn Tofu
You’ve just made a delicious batch of Taiwanese Popcorn Tofu, and while it’s best enjoyed fresh, sometimes you have leftovers or want to prepare ahead. Don’t worry, storing and reheating is straightforward, ensuring you can savor your Homemade Taiwanese popcorn tofu for longer.
To store, first allow the tofu to cool completely to room temperature. Then, transfer it to an airtight container. It will keep well in the refrigerator for 3-4 days. For longer storage, you can freeze your cooked Taiwanese Popcorn Tofu. Place the cooled pieces on a baking sheet in a single layer and freeze until solid, then transfer them to a freezer-safe bag or container. It will last for up to 3 months.
When reheating, avoid the microwave if you want to retain crispiness. Instead, spread the tofu on a baking sheet and reheat in a preheated oven at 375°F (190°C) for 10-15 minutes, or until heated through and crispy again. Alternatively, an air fryer at 350°F (175°C) for 5-7 minutes works wonders for bringing back that perfect crunch to your Homemade Taiwanese popcorn tofu.
Frequently Asked Questions About Taiwanese Popcorn Tofu
What is Taiwanese popcorn tofu?
Taiwanese Popcorn Tofu is a popular vegan snack and street food from Taiwan. It features bite-sized pieces of tofu that are marinated in a savory blend of spices, coated in a tapioca starch mixture, and then deep-fried until golden brown and crispy. It’s often seasoned with an additional spice blend and served with fried basil leaves, making it a delicious plant-based alternative to traditional popcorn chicken.
How does Taiwanese popcorn tofu compare to popcorn chicken?
While both are crispy, bite-sized fried snacks, Taiwanese Popcorn Tofu offers a plant-based experience. Popcorn chicken uses actual chicken, whereas this dish uses tofu, providing a similar satisfying texture and flavor profile through clever marination and frying techniques. Many find the texture of crispy fried tofu to be incredibly similar to chicken, especially when prepared with these authentic Taiwanese flavors.
Can I bake or air fry Taiwanese popcorn tofu instead of deep-frying?
Yes, you can! While deep-frying yields the crispiest and most authentic texture for Taiwanese Popcorn Tofu, baking or air frying are healthier alternatives. For air frying, lightly spray the coated tofu with oil and cook at 400°F (200°C) for 15-20 minutes, flipping halfway. For baking, bake at 425°F (220°C) for 25-30 minutes, flipping once. The texture won’t be quite as crispy as deep-fried, but it will still be delicious.
What dipping sauces pair best with Taiwanese popcorn tofu?
I love serving Taiwanese Popcorn Tofu with a variety of dipping sauces! Classic options include sweet chili sauce, a spicy sriracha mayo, or a simple soy-ginger dipping sauce. You can also make a homemade garlic-infused soy sauce with a touch of vinegar for an authentic Taiwanese street food experience. Experiment to find your favorite combination!
Variations of Taiwanese Popcorn Tofu You Can Try
One of the things I love most about cooking is the ability to customize dishes, and Taiwanese Popcorn Tofu is no exception! This recipe is incredibly versatile, allowing you to experiment with different flavors and cooking methods. Here are a few variations I’ve tried that keep this snack exciting and fresh.
For those who love a kick, try making a Spicy Taiwanese popcorn tofu. Simply add a teaspoon of chili powder or cayenne pepper to the marinade, and a pinch more to your final seasoning mix. You can also drizzle hot chili oil over the finished product for an extra fiery punch. This variation really wakes up the taste buds!
If you’re looking for a gluten-free option, ensure you use tamari instead of light soy sauce and confirm your five-spice powder is gluten-free. Tapioca starch is naturally gluten-free, making it an easy swap for a delicious and safe meal. You can also experiment with different herb seasonings; while basil is traditional, a mix of cilantro and mint can offer a refreshing twist to your Taiwanese Popcorn Tofu.
Another fun variation is to include different vegetables in the marinade, such as finely grated carrots or zucchini, which add extra moisture and nutrients. You could also try baking or air-frying for a lighter take on this crispy favorite, though I still prefer the deep-fried version for its authentic crunch.
Print
Taiwanese Popcorn Tofu: 1 Crave-Worthy Recipe
- Total Time: 4 hours 35 minutes
- Yield: 4 servings 1x
- Diet: Vegan
Description
Crispy Taiwanese Popcorn Tofu is a vegan snack. It features tofu coated in starch and fried until golden brown. This dish is seasoned with aromatic spices and served with crispy basil leaves. It is a satisfying plant-based alternative to traditional popcorn chicken.
Ingredients
- 1 block Extra Firm Tofu (frozen and thawed for better texture)
- 2 tablespoons Light Soy Sauce (or tamari for gluten-free)
- 1 tablespoon Shaoxing Wine (or rice vinegar for non-alcoholic)
- 1 teaspoon Five Spice Powder (or garam masala)
- 1/2 teaspoon White Pepper (or black pepper)
- 2 tablespoons Corn Starch
- 1 cup Tapioca Starch (or arrowroot starch)
- 1 cup Thai Basil Leaves (or regular basil)
- to taste Seasoning (Five Spice, White Pepper, Salt, Paprika)
Instructions
- Marinate Tofu: In a mixing bowl, combine light soy sauce, Shaoxing wine, five spice powder, white pepper, salt, and corn starch. Stir until smooth. Add cubed extra firm tofu, ensuring it is well-coated. Cover and refrigerate for 20 minutes to 4 hours for maximum flavor absorption.
- Prepare for Frying: Pour tapioca starch into a shallow dish. Heat enough oil in a frying pan over medium-high heat until hot.
- Coat Tofu: Retrieve the marinated tofu. Carefully dredge each piece in the tapioca starch, ensuring an even coating.
- Fry Tofu: Gently lower the coated tofu pieces into the hot oil in batches. Fry for 5-6 minutes, or until golden brown, stirring occasionally.
- Fry Basil: Add fresh Thai basil leaves to the oil during the last minute of cooking.
- Finish Dish: Transfer crispy tofu and basil onto a paper towel-lined plate to drain excess oil. Mix your ground seasoning and generously sprinkle it over the hot tofu and fried basil for an enhanced flavor.
Notes
- Serve your Taiwanese popcorn tofu with sweet chili or soy dipping sauce for additional flavor.
- Ensure the oil is hot enough before frying to achieve a crispy texture.
- For best flavor, marinate the tofu for several hours.
- Fry tofu in small batches to maintain oil temperature and prevent sticking.
- Let the tofu drain on paper towels after frying to absorb excess oil.
- Prep Time: 20 minutes
- Cook Time: 15 minutes
- Category: APPETIZERS
- Method: Deep Frying
- Cuisine: Taiwanese
Nutrition
- Serving Size: 1 serving
- Calories: 250 kcal
- Sugar: 1 g
- Sodium: 600 mg
- Fat: 15 g
- Saturated Fat: 1 g
- Unsaturated Fat: 9 g
- Trans Fat: 0 g
- Carbohydrates: 20 g
- Fiber: 2 g
- Protein: 12 g
- Cholesterol: 0 mg












Leave a Reply